Breaking Down the Features of Ruger 4BHM Single Medium Hawkeye Ring

Specifications

  • The Ruger 4BHM Single Medium Hawkeye Ring is designed for Ruger firearms with the Hawkeye dovetail mounting system. It is a medium-height ring.

  • The ring is constructed from steel and features a blued finish. This provides adequate strength and corrosion resistance.

  • It’s designed to fit scopes with a one-inch tube diameter. This is a standard size and fits most common scopes.

  • The ring’s medium height allows for proper scope clearance on many rifles. This specification ensures proper alignment and prevents interference with the rifle’s action.

Conclusion on Ruger 4BHM Single Medium Hawkeye Ring

The Ruger 4BHM Single Medium Hawkeye Ring is a decent, functional scope ring that performs its basic job adequately. However, the decision to sell it as a single ring is baffling and significantly detracts from its value. It is a major inconvenience for the consumer.

The price is justifiable if you consider that you need to buy two, effectively doubling the advertised cost. I would only recommend this product with a major caveat: be prepared to buy two. I would recommend that Ruger change this practice.

Ultimately, while the ring itself isn’t bad, the purchasing experience leaves a sour taste. Unless you’re a die-hard Ruger fan or find these rings at a significantly discounted price, there are better, more convenient options available.
